标签:pre javascrip set log ons 动态绑定 方法 title console
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
</head>
<body>
<h1>angular.bind</h1>
<p>
<span>使用方法:</span><br />
<span>angular.bind(self, fn, args)</span>
</p>
<p>
<span>参数:</span><br />
<span>self: Object,fn的上下文对象,使用this调用</span><br />
<span>fn: Function,被绑定的fn</span><br />
<span>args:传入fn中的参数(可选)</span>
</p>
<p>
<span>返回值:</span><br />
<span>返回动态绑定之后的函数</span>
</p>
</body>
<script src="../../js/angular.1.3.0.js" type="text/javascript" charset="utf-8"></script>
<script type="text/javascript">
var obj = {name: ‘张三‘};
// 带参数
var fn1 = angular.bind(obj, function(age){
console.log(this.name + ‘是‘ + age);
}, ‘15岁!‘)
fn1();
var fn2 = angular.bind(obj, function(age){
console.log(this.name + ‘是‘ + age);
})
fn2(‘18岁了!‘);
</script>
</html>
标签:pre javascrip set log ons 动态绑定 方法 title console
原文地址:https://www.cnblogs.com/tanxiang6690/p/9764629.html